The High Price of Ice

Old Grandpa Jones slipped and fell on the ice Poor fellow paid a mighty heavy price He broke twenty-nine bones All day long, moans and groans Hey, Gramps: You're one big prosthetic device December 29, 2020 Winter Snow or Ice Limerick Contest Sponsor: Tania Kitchin Syllable Counts -- 10 10 7 7 10 -- Poetry Soup Syllable Checker
